Cooking kills the things that were present in the food when first cooked. It has no effects on the things that land on your food and grow after it cools down to room temperature. Update to updated question: Cooking does not destroy some toxins that were in the food. read more

Some bacteria cause fewer cases of food poisoning but can make you very sick. They can even cause death. They include: E. coli. This is the name of a type of bacteria found in the intestines of animals. You can get this from undercooked ground beef, unpasteurized milk, sprouts, or any food or liquid that has had contact with animal feces or sewage. read more
